Rom, Italien - On April 24, 2025, the Austrian tennis players Lukas Neumayer and Sandro Kopp achieved the semi -finals of the ATP Challenger 50 tournament in Rome. Both of them prevailed in exciting matches and are now facing the possibility of an Austrian final.
Lukas Neumayer, 22 years old, showed a strong performance against the four-set Timofey Skatov (ATP-172). He won the match 6: 3, 7: 6 (3) and benefited from a surcharge break in the first set. In the second, the Austrian prevailed after a gap of 2: 4 in the tie break with 7: 3. He also successfully switched off his previous opponents, Mili Poljicak (ATP-268) and Lukas Pokorny (qualified).
semi-finals and ranking updates
Neumayer meets the top seeds of Lithuania Vilius Gaubas (ATP-149), who previously won two victories against Sebastian Ofner and won a Challenger tournament in Menorca. With the move into the semi -finals, Neumayer has improved his career high and is now in 191, with the possibility of even reaching the top 170 by winning the semi -finals.
Also Sandro Kopp, a Tyrolean qualifying, was able to convince: he defeated the Italian Federico Arnaboldi (ATP-200) 6: 2, 6: 4. Kopp managed to move into the quarter -finals after four qualification victories, and with this success he will be among the top 400 of the world rankings again from Monday. In the semifinals, the winner of the duel between Matteo Gigante and Francesco Maestrelli is still waiting for him.
background to the ATP Challenger Tour
The ATP Challenger Tour includes a number of important men's tennis tournaments that are located below the ATP Tour, but on the ITF Future Tour. These events offer players the opportunity to collect valuable ranking points. In the case of the Challenger tournaments, the prize money is between $ 60,000 and $ 230,000, with prize money from 2025 with $ 28.5 million.
Since the Challenger tour has existed since 1978, it has increased significantly in recent decades and today comprises numerous tournaments worldwide. The regulation that top 50 players are not allowed to play Challenger events was canceled, which increases the competition at this level.
